Key Words:

 impose: 1) place a (penalty, tax, etc.) officially on sb./sth. 

   e.g: The government has made a decision to impose a further tax on wines and spirits. 

        The local government tried to impose fines on the factories which poured 

untreated waste into the river. 

         2) try to make sb. accept (an opinion or belief) 

   e.g: I wouldn't want to impose my religious convictions on anyone.  

  It may not be wise for parents to impose their own tastes on their children.

 exploit1)n. brave and adventurous deed or action(usu. pl)功绩,业绩 

e.g. The general‟s wartime exploits were later made into a film and a television series. 

My grandfather entertained us with stories of wartime exploits. vt. 1) to use (esp. a person) unfairly for one‟s own profit  剥削 

e.g. The cruel boss exploited the poor by making them work for less pay.

 2) to use or develop (a thing) fully so as to get profit

 e.g. to exploit the oil under the sea  n. exploitation 

 disguise

1) give sb./ sth. a false appearance 

  (used in the pattern: disguise sb./ sth. as)     假扮,伪装 

e.g. Mulan disguised herself as a man so she could fight on the battlefield. Jack escaped across the border disguised as a priest. 

2) hide (the real state of things) 伪装,掩饰,隐藏

It is impossible to disguise the fact that the  business is bad.  16. in the eyes of: in the opinion of , in one‟s opinion  

e.g. In the eyes of students, Richard is a sensible and reliable teacher. 

 In the eye of my parents, I‟m still a young person although I am already in my 

thirties. 

 peer: look closely or carefully , esp. as if unable to see well ( followed by at/ 

through/ into, etc.)凝视,盯着看 

e.g. She peered through the mist, trying to find the right path.      He peered at me over the top of his glasses. 

     He peered into his parents` room and found they were quarrelling. 

 bid:  say, wish ( bid----bid----bid   bid----bad----bidden)说,致意     

e.g. He bad me good morning as he passed . 2) order or tell 命令,吩咐

 transport  

vcarry from one place to anotherconvey.运输;运送 

The goods were transported by train 

货物是用火车来运输的。 

    Trains transport the coal to the ports     火车把煤运到港口。 

abolish  

vt. do away with;destroy completely取消;废除;废止;革除     Should the death penalty be abolished?    应当废除死刑吗

settlement 

1) n. a place where people have come to settle新村落,定居地,拓居地    These tools ale found in an early Iron Age settlement. 

    这些工具是在早期石器时代的村落发现的。 

2)all agreement or decision ending an argument, question, etc. 争执、问题等的解决;和解     

The management has reached a settlement with the union over the pay dispute. 

    资方与工会就工资纠纷达成了协议。 

Key Phrases:

stand up (for)

坚决维护;捍卫 If you stand up for someone or something, you defend them and make your feelings or opinions very clear.

They stood up for what they believed to be right...他们坚决捍卫自己认为是对的事。

Don't be afraid to stand up for yourself. 要敢于维护自己的权利。

区别

stand up

(1)(要求或证据)经得起检验,能够成立 If something such as a claim or a piece of evidence stands up, it is accepted as true or satisfactory after being carefully examined.

He made wild accusations that did not stand up... 他的指控毫无根据,根本站不住脚。

How well does this thesis stand up to close examination? 这个命题经得起推敲吗?

(2)(男友或女友)爽约,放…的鸽子 If a boyfriend or girlfriend stands you up, they fail to keep an arrangement to meet you.

We were to have had dinner together yesterday evening, but he stood me up...

我们昨晚本来要一起吃晚饭的,但他爽约了。

He was in a foul mood because he had been stood up. 他因女友爽约而心情不好。

be intent on (sth./doing sth.) be eager and determined to (do sth.) 热衷于,坚决要做

on the side as an additional job or source of income; secretly 作为兼职;秘密地

close in (on/around) come near to, esp. in order to attack from several directions; surround接近;包围

as for with regard to至于

make the best ofaccept an unsatisfactory situation cheerfully and try to manage as well as you can尽量利用,充分利用

in the eyes of in the opinion of在(某人)看来

at risk threatened by the possibility of loss, failure, etc.; in danger有危险;冒风险

pass for appear like; be accepted or looked upon as被看做;被当成

Key Sentences:

 1. Josiah Henson is but one name on a long list of courageous men and women who together forged the Underground Railroad, a secret web of escape routes and safe houses that they used to liberate slaves from the American South.

乔赛亚·亨森只是一长串无所畏惧的男女名单中的一个名字,这些人共同创建了这条地下铁路,一条由逃亡线路和可靠的人家组成的用以解放美国南方黑奴的秘密网络。

2.For the heroes of the Underground Railroad remain too little remembered, their exploits still largely unsung.

因为地下铁路的英雄们依然默默无闻,他们的业绩依然没有多少颂扬

3.In Kentucky, where he was now headed, there was a $1000 reward for his capture, dead or alive.

在他正前往的肯塔基州,当局悬赏1000美元抓他,无论死了的还是活着的可以

4.10 The others made it to the Ohio shore, where Parker hurriedly arranged for a wagon to take them to the next "station" on the Underground Railroad - the first leg of their journey to safety in Canada. Over the course of his life, John Parker guided more than 400 slaves to safety.

其他的人都上了岸,帕克急忙安排了一辆车把他们带到地下铁路的下一”――他们走向安全的加拿大之旅的第一程。约翰·帕克在有生之年一共带领400多名黑奴走向安全之地。(leg = part)

5.Making the best of his lot, Henson worked diligently and rose far in his owner's regard.

亨森非常认命,干活勤勉,深受主人器重。(lot = fate)
